Ron,

Foxboro has them,

DI700AJ_1v16 (Modbus Master protocol for device integrator)

DI700AK_1v13 (Modbus Slave protocol for device integrator)

Both for the v344 image.

For some reason, these manuals are not included in the Electronic Documentation 
CD for versions 6-7.
